Influence of Salinity on Vegetative Growth of Six Native Mediterranean Species

摘要

High salinity can reduce plant growth and leaf area, which is detrimental to quality, especially in ornamental crops. The study of the behavior of ornamental plants that are tolerant to saline waters can be an advantage in areas with poor-quality irrigation water. The aim of this work was to study the influence of the fertigation water salinity on the vegetative growth of six Mediterranean crops. The species studied were Asteriscus maritimus, Crithmum maritimum, Sarcocornia fruticosa, Halimione portulacoides, Lavandula multiflda and Limonium cossonianum. Plants were cultivated during 60 days in pots with a mixture of peat:perlite 80:20 (v/v) in a polyethylene greenhouse. Three nutrient solutions with different salt concentrations were applied: Tl (100 mM), T2 (200 mM) and T3 (300 mM), obtained with the application of different amounts of sodium chloride (NaCI) to the fertigation water. Crithmum maritimum, Sarcoconia fructicosa and Halimione portulacoides had a positive response when salinity levelrise. Nevertheless, a significant reduction in leaf and total fresh and dry weight were detected due to the salinity concentration increase in Asteriscus maritimus and Lavandula multiflda. The 200 and 300 mM NaCl treatments resulted in a growth reductionof more than 20 and 29% in Asteriscus maritimus and 31 and 52% in Lavandula multiflda, respectively. Moreover, foliar injuries have been observed in Lavandula multiflda and Limonium cossonianum in the treatments with the highest salt concentration.
